We’re looking for an experienced attorney to join our team of business lawyers providing legal support for consumer product, technology, and regulatory matters. This attorney will partner closely with our product, engineering, procurement, IP, and compliance teams to advance Bose’s consumer product businesses. They will provide timely and practical legal advice in a fast-paced environment, with careful balancing of risks in light of commercial and strategic goals. Main responsibilities include drafting, review and negotiation of various types of contracts; regulatory monitoring, interpretation and advising on designated compliance topics; implementing various legal processes in business operations; and general legal counseling across multiple teams.
Ideal candidates will have significant experience in drafting and negotiating complex commercial agreements, including agreements with significant IP implications such as joint development agreements or technology transfer agreements. They will have experience identifying, interpreting and advising on global regulatory requirements. They will be skilled at helping business teams navigate novel legal and business requirements. They will have experience working with B2C business models and related legal issues. They will be tech-savvy and tech-interested. They will have experience in assessing risk and influencing outcomes that appropriately balance risk mitigation with business objectives. They will be strong, clear communicators who exhibit tenacity and grit in the face of challenging situations. They will be interested in the operational and execution activities of the transactions on which they work. They will have excellent attention to detail, especially in ensuring accuracy of complicated regulatory regimes and contract provisions. They will be intellectually curious, patient and practical problem solvers who maintain big-picture perspective while managing day-to-day business needs.
